This is a screenshot for the software Enceladus Web and FTP Server Suite. Enceladus Server Suite - Enceladus is a Internet/Intranet Web and FTP Server for Windows, provides secure file sharing on any network! Provides the average user with a easy to use, complete, Turn-Key. The current version is 2.6.
